Uncaught TypeError: Cannot read properties of undefined (reading 'startTime') in getCLS logic #6083

Steps to Reproduce

Move the mouse around on an element creating a layout shift (eg a row that expands on hover)

Expected Result

No error

Actual Result

Js error on line
https://github.com/getsentry/sentry-javascript/blob/master/packages/tracing/src/browser/web-vitals/getCLS.ts#L64
Uncaught TypeError: Cannot read properties of undefined (reading 'startTime')

image

firstSessionEntry and lastSessionEntry are undefined but being used without any check

@philipwalton
Copy link

@philipwalton do we have to adjust the logic in web vitals repo - or is this a case that shouldn't be possible?

I don't believe this case should be possible, so I'm not sure how it's happening here.

Referencing the startTime property of firstSessionEntry and lastSessionEntry only ever happens behind a check for sessionValue being truthy, and the only way session sessionValue can be truthy is if session entries have also been set.

I'd need more context for the error report in order to know whether or not it reflects a real case or perhaps just a fluke error.

Looking through the changes for the Web Vitals v3 update I performed, the sessionEntries.length !== 0 check has been lost from here:

Before:

if (
sessionValue &&
sessionEntries.length !== 0 &&
entry.startTime - lastSessionEntry.startTime < 1000 &&
entry.startTime - firstSessionEntry.startTime < 5000
) {

After:

if (
sessionValue &&
entry.startTime - lastSessionEntry.startTime < 1000 &&
entry.startTime - firstSessionEntry.startTime < 5000
) {

This check was added in this PR but as far as I can tell, the sessionEntries.length check has never existed in the Web Vitals source.

Humm well now that I reverted to previous version and reupgraded to make a reproduction, I'm trying the same thing as before and it's not happening at all... When before it was always happening 🤔

Looking at the source, it does make sense it wouldn't happen because sessionValue starts at 0 and only gets set when sessionEntries gets set as well.. All variables seem scoped so unless there is some black magic happening with object references. This is a WTF moment

The only thing that makes sense is this is a race condition between the extremely short amount of time sessionValue = entry.value; and sessionEntries = [entry]; are executed, the handleEntries fires another time from another event, so unless it fires 3000 times a second I don't see this happening all the time like it did before

@timfish for the time being let’s just add a Boolean check to the conditional to unblock users? We can then cut a patch release with that.

We can always revert it later when we investigate more and reproduce it.
